备份数据库:优选何种硬盘最佳?
备份数据库用什么硬盘

首页 2025-03-30 01:03:05



备份数据库:如何选择最合适的硬盘 备份数据库是企业和个人确保数据安全、防范数据丢失风险的重要措施

    选择合适的硬盘进行数据库备份,不仅关乎数据的完整性,还直接影响到数据恢复的效率

    本文将从硬盘类型、性能、容量、数据安全、预算等多个维度,详细探讨如何为备份数据库选择最合适的硬盘

     一、硬盘类型:固态硬盘(SSD) vs. 企业级硬盘(HDD) vs. 混合硬盘(SSHD) 在选择备份数据库的硬盘时,首先要考虑的是硬盘的类型

    目前市场上主要有固态硬盘(SSD)、企业级硬盘(HDD)和混合硬盘(SSHD)三种类型

     1. 固态硬盘(SSD) 固态硬盘以其高速读写性能和低延迟,成为了数据库应用的最佳选择

    对于备份数据库而言,SSD同样表现出色

    它能够极大提升数据备份和恢复的速度,缩短数据重建的时间

    此外,SSD还具有抗震性好、体积小、重量轻等优点,适合在移动环境中使用

    然而,SSD的价格相对较高,容量相对较小,且寿命可能受到写入次数的限制

    尽管如此,对于需要频繁读取和写入大量数据的数据库备份而言,SSD仍然是一个值得考虑的选择

     2. 企业级硬盘(HDD) 企业级硬盘通常提供较大的存储容量,适合用于需要存储大量数据的场景

    对于数据库备份而言,HDD的性价比更高,能够满足大容量存储的需求

    此外,HDD的技术相对成熟,可靠性较高,数据保存时间较长

    然而,HDD的读写速度相对较慢,尤其是在处理大量小文件时

    此外,HDD比较怕震动和碰撞,需要在使用时轻拿轻放

     3. 混合硬盘(SSHD) 混合硬盘结合了SSD和HDD的优点,通过将常用的数据存储在SSD部分,提高了数据的读取速度,而大容量的数据则存储在HDD部分,实现了性能和容量的平衡

    对于预算有限但又需要一定性能的应用场景,SSHD是一个不错的选择

    然而,SSHD的性能提升可能不如纯SSD那么显著,且价格也可能高于单纯的HDD

     二、性能考虑:读写速度、IOPS和延迟 在选择备份数据库的硬盘时,性能是一个不可忽视的因素

    性能的好坏直接影响到数据备份和恢复的速度

     1. 读写速度 读写速度是衡量硬盘性能的重要指标

    对于数据库备份而言,读写速度越快,数据备份和恢复的时间就越短

    SSD在这方面表现出色,其读写速度远远超过HDD

    然而,对于只需要偶尔备份数据且对速度要求不高的场景,HDD的读写速度可能已经足够

     2. IOPS(每秒输入/输出操作数) IOPS是衡量硬盘处理小文件读写操作能力的指标

    对于数据库备份而言,IOPS越高,处理大量小文件的能力就越强

    SSD的IOPS远高于HDD,因此更适合处理大量小文件的数据库备份

     3. 延迟 延迟是指硬盘从接收到读写指令到开始执行指令的时间

    对于数据库备份而言,延迟越低,数据备份和恢复的响应时间就越短

    SSD的延迟远低于HDD,因此能够提供更快速的数据备份和恢复体验

     三、容量规划:根据数据量和增长需求选择 在选择备份数据库的硬盘时,容量是一个重要的考虑因素

    需要根据当前的数据量和未来的增长需求来选择合适的容量

     1. 确定当前数据量 首先,需要明确当前需要备份的数据量

    这包括数据库文件、日志文件、索引文件等

    可以通过查看数据库管理系统提供的统计信息或使用专门的磁盘空间分析工具来确定当前数据量

     2. 考虑未来增长需求 其次,需要考虑未来数据量的增长需求

    数据库中的数据通常会随着时间的推移而不断增加

    因此,在选择备份硬盘时,需要预留一定的空间以满足未来的需求

    可以通过分析历史数据增长趋势或根据业务需求来预测未来的数据量增长

     3. 选择合适的容量 最后,根据当前数据量和未来增长需求来选择合适的硬盘容量

    常见的备份存储设备容量有500GB、1TB、2TB、4TB等

    如果数据量较小,可以选择容量较小的硬盘;如果数据量较大,可以考虑大容量的外置硬盘、网络存储设备(NAS)等

     四、数据安全:RAID配置和加密技术 数据安全是备份数据库时需要考虑的重要因素

    通过RAID配置和加密技术,可以增强数据的安全性和完整性

     1. RAID配置 RAID(独立冗余磁盘阵列)是一种将多个硬盘组合在一起以提高性能和冗余性的技术

    常见的RAID级别包括RAID 0、RAID 1、RAID 5和RAID 10等

    RAID 0通过数据条带化将数据分散到多个硬盘上,提高读写速度,但没有冗余性;RAID 1通过镜像备份,将数据同时写入两块硬盘中,提供冗余性但性能可能会稍微降低;RAID 5和RAID 10则是性能和冗余性的平衡选择

    对于数据库备份而言,RAID配置可以提高数据的安全性和可靠性,即使一块硬盘出现故障,数据仍然可以从其他硬盘中读取

     2. 加密技术 加密技术可以保护存储在硬盘上的数据不被未经授权的人访问

    一些移动硬盘和U盘提供了硬件加密功能,可以设置密码保护数据

    此外,一些存储设备还具有防震、防水、防尘等功能,可以保护数据在意外情况下不受损坏

    对于需要更高安全性要求的数据库备份,可以选择具有数据加密和保护功能的存储设备

     五、预算考虑:性价比和长期成本 在选择备份数据库的硬盘时,预算也是一个重要的考虑因素

    不同类型的硬盘具有不同的价格,且价格差异较大

    因此,需要根据自己的预算来选择合适的硬盘

     1. 性价比 性价比是衡量硬盘价格与其性能之间关系的指标

    在选择硬盘时,需要综合考虑其价格、性能、容量、数据安全等因素,选择性价比高的硬盘

    例如,对于只需要偶尔备份数据且对速度要求不高的场景,可以选择价格相对较低但容量较大的HDD;对于需要频繁读取和写入大量数据的场景,可以选择性能更高但价格相对较贵的SSD

     2. 长期成本 除了考虑硬盘的购买成本外,还需要考虑其长期成本

    例如,如果选择云存储服务进行数据库备份,需要考虑订阅费用的长期支出;而对于物理存储设备,可能需要考虑设备的维护、更换和升级成本

    在选择备份存储设备时,要综合考虑短期和长期成本,选择一个符合自己预算和需求的产品

     六、知名品牌推荐 在选择备份数据库的硬盘时,品牌也是一个不可忽视的因素

    知名品牌的产品在生产工艺、质量控制、售后服务等方面都有一定的保障

    以下是一些市场上知名的硬盘品牌及其产品推荐: 1. 西部数据(Western Digital) 西部数据的My Passport系列移动硬盘凭借其出色的性能和高耐用性获得了广大用户的青睐

    该系列硬盘设计紧凑、便于携带,适合需要随时随地存储和备份数据的用户

    此外,My Passport还支持USB 3.0接口,传输速度高达5Gbps,满足日常文件存储和高速数据传输的需求

    同时,西部数据还为其提供了强大的加密保护功能,确保存储在硬盘上的数据不被未经授权的人访问

     2. 希捷(Seagate) 希捷的Backup Plus Portable系列移动硬盘同样是一款适合日常备份和高效传输的硬盘

    该系列硬盘提供从1TB到5TB不等的多个容量选择,能够满足不同用户的需求

    通过USB 3.0接口,Backup Plus能够提供高达120MB/s的传输速度

    在耐用性方面,Backup Plus同样表现不凡,拥有坚固的外壳,能够有效抵御外界的震动和冲击

    此外,该系列硬盘还附带了Seagate Dashboard软件,用户可以轻松管理备份任务,实现一键备份

     3. 三星(Samsung) 三星的T系列移动固态硬盘以其高性能和紧凑设计而著称

    例如,三星T5移动固态硬盘采用了高性能的SSD固态存储技术,读取速度可达540MB/s,写入速度可达500MB/s

    对于需要频繁读取和写入大量数据的用户来说,这款硬盘无疑能够提供更高效的工作体验

    此外,T5还支持AES 256位硬件加密技术,能够有效保护用户的私人数据

     七、总结 备份数据库是一项重要的任务,选择合适的硬盘至关重要

    在选择备份数据库的硬盘时,需要考虑硬盘类型、性能、容量、数据安全、预算等多个因素

    固态硬盘以其高速读写性能和低延迟成为首选;企业级硬盘适合大容量存储且对性能要求不高的场景;混合硬盘则提供了性能和容量的平衡

    同时,还需要根据当前数据量和未来增长需求来选择合适的硬盘容量;通过RAID配置和加密技术来增强数据的安全性和完整性;根据自己的预算来选择性价比高的硬盘,并考

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道